People often assume Ludo is pure luck — you roll a dice and you get what you get. That is partially true, but anyone who has played seriously knows there is a meaningful skill element that separates consistent winners from occasional lucky players. Understanding when to stay on a safe square versus advancing to an exposed position, when to prioritise bringing out new tokens versus pushing your front-runner home, and how to cut off an opponent's token at the right moment — these decisions accumulate into a real edge over time.
